The usual way is to grab a AA battery and connect the two ends of the wires to it. If you hear a pop in a speaker, then those two wires belong to those speakers.

Then, to see which is + and -, you connect the AA again, and see what way the cone of the speaker moves. If it moves outwards, the wire that is connected to the + of the AA battery is the +.

Stock speakers will survive, but dunno how good it'll sound  ??? If you're getting new speakers, i'd recommend re-doing the wiring. It aint that hard :)

there should be four sets of leads fomr the headunit, each pair color coded diff. the negative cable has a black stripe on it. plug the front left speaker in. fade to front left and if you have sound you have foiund the pair of front left speaker wires. get it? all trial and error unless you have the h/u instruction booklet.
forget the common ground thing, just run both cable to the h/u fomr the speaker, extend if need be. not hard at all.
